KNOW THE SYMPTOMS

How to Identify Potential Mold Issues in Your Bullard Residence

While extensive mold infestations are undeniable, often the initial signs in a property are more discreet. Swift recognition of these indicators is critical to prevent widespread structural damage and serious health complications. If you identify any of the following in your home, it’s a clear signal to contact IICRC-certified home remediation specialists for a comprehensive assessment.

Indicators Suggesting Home Mold Presence:

  • Pervasive Damp or Earthy Aroma: A strong, persistent musty odor that lingers, particularly in areas like basements, attics, or crawl spaces, is a prime indicator of hidden mold growth. This scent suggests active microbial activity, even if the mold itself is unseen, requiring certified residential cleanup.
  • Unexplained Respiratory Ailments: If occupants experience ongoing respiratory issues, persistent coughing, nasal irritation, or shortness of breath that seems to worsen indoors, it may be a reaction to airborne mold. Health-safe remediation often addresses these concerns by removing the source.
  • Visual Patches of Dark Growth: Look for any suspicious dark-colored patches, typically black, dark green, or even slimy, appearing on walls, ceilings, or areas with previous moisture. These growths could signify mold, necessitating professional removal for homes.
  • Material Softness or Deterioration: Feel for softness or sponginess in drywall, or observe any bubbling paint or warped flooring, particularly in bathrooms or laundry areas. These are physical manifestations of moisture damage, providing ideal conditions for insidious mold to thrive out of sight.
  • History of Moisture Challenges: Any property with unresolved past water leaks, consistent condensation, or inadequate dehumidification is highly susceptible to hidden mold. These ongoing moisture challenges create an environment ripe for effective remediation for homeowners.

Does my homeowners insurance policy cover mold remediation?

Homeowners insurance coverage for mold remediation is highly dependent on your specific policy and the original cause of the water damage leading to mold. If the mold resulted from a sudden and accidental event (e.g., a burst pipe or covered storm damage), it may be covered. However, mold from long-term neglect or humidity is typically excluded. Our insured mold removal specialists can assist with documentation for your claim process.

What is the difference between mold vs. mildew removal in houses?

Understanding mold vs. mildew removal in houses is important. Mildew is generally a surface-level fungus, often white or gray, and might be cleaned with household products. Mold, however, can be various colors, often fuzzy or slimy, and penetrates deeper into materials, posing greater health risks and structural damage. Professional mold removal for homes is required for effective and safe mold spore eradication, especially for more pervasive infestations.

How can I prevent mold in homes after professional cleanup?

To prevent mold in homes after professional cleanup, consistent moisture control is key. This includes ensuring proper ventilation fixes to stop mold, maintaining optimal indoor humidity levels (ideally below 60%) using best dehumidifiers for mold prevention, and promptly repairing any leaks. We provide tailored post-remediation maintenance tips to empower homeowners with strategies for long-term mold prevention.

What are the key signs you need professional mold remediation?

Key signs you need professional mold remediation include a persistent musty odor, visible mold growth exceeding a small area (more than 10 square feet), recurring allergy or respiratory symptoms when indoors, or mold appearing after significant water damage like flooding. These indicators suggest a larger, underlying problem that requires the expertise of IICRC-certified home mold remediation specialists for safe and effective resolution.
